From d5297540b17e1fe8ff0971bbc06184eb29c080e6 Mon Sep 17 00:00:00 2001 From: EuAndreh Date: Tue, 22 Jun 2021 18:18:05 -0300 Subject: aux/tests-lib.sh: Add uuid() function, use it on tests --- aux/tests-lib.sh | 8 ++++++++ 1 file changed, 8 insertions(+) (limited to 'aux/tests-lib.sh') diff --git a/aux/tests-lib.sh b/aux/tests-lib.sh index 0be4e6f..007282a 100755 --- a/aux/tests-lib.sh +++ b/aux/tests-lib.sh @@ -102,3 +102,11 @@ test_ok() { # shellcheck disable=2059 printf " ${green}OK${end}.\n" >&2 } + +uuid() { + # Taken from: + # https://serverfault.com/a/799198 + od -xN20 /dev/urandom | \ + head -1 | \ + awk '{OFS="-"; print $2$3,$4,$5,$6,$7$8$9}' +} -- cgit v1.2.3